Software Engineer (PHP/Laravel) – Backend/API

We are looking for a well-rounded Software Developer to join our API team and help us drive the development of the second generation of our SaaS platform. We currently have a monolith (in Laravel) that we will be decoupling into smaller services.

Software Engineer (PHP/Laravel) – Backend/API

Zaventem, Belgium
Permanent - Full time
M / V / X

We are EasyOrder, and we have the ambition to take our place in the Food Tech Industry by providing a strong suite of products to our merchants at an affordable price tag and helping the digitalization of an entire sector. In addition, we provide web and personalized mobile apps and allow merchants to understand their customers and optimize their conversions.

We are looking for a well-rounded Software Developer to join our API team and help us drive the development of the second generation of our SaaS platform. We currently have a monolith (in Laravel) that we will be decoupling into more minor services.

Our offer

  • 100% remote work, but we still have an office in Zaventem if you want to meet your colleagues
  • Pair programming over Slack if that’s what you like
  • An environment where we take the time to do things the right way with the freedom to experiment and grow your skills
  • A no meeting policy so you can truly focus on your work
  • The chance to have a significant impact on a project as we are still a small team
  • A nice and up to date tech stack
  • A CI/CD environment where we deploy stories as soon as they are reviewed & tested
  • A great salary package adapted to your experience

Responsibilities & duties

  • You will work on our API, which is currently a monolith that we want to slowly break down into micro-services
  • You will build micro-services for the new services
  • You will make sure our API is always up-and-running
  • You will integrate with our partners and their API’s
  • You will think with other teammates how to scale the API, how to implement the performance testing, the caching, ...
  • You will be writing high-quality code alongside beautiful unit tests to meet our definition of done
  • You will always care about the technical debt on the project and will be expected to point things to improve proactively
  • You will be working with your team to resolve problems and deliver solutions

Requirements

  • +6 years in Software Development using PHP and its eco-system
  • Good experience using Design Patterns and writing clean code  (SOLID principles, Clean Architecture, ...)
  • Experience in designing and building API’s
  • Experience writing Unit Tests- Experience reviewing code of others and providing constructive feedback
  • Experience working in an Agile environment

We are not bound to a specific technology and we are expecting you to  keep an open mind to learn new things but here are some techs we are  using today: PHP 7.4, Laravel 8, MySQL, Redis, Angular 12, Capacitor,  IONIC 5, AWS, Netlify, Bitbucket, ...